How do i replace the hall sensor?
I want to replace the hall sensor on my S2 as it is faulty.
There are 2 x 4mm allen key bolts attaching it to the back of the cam pully drive gear cover. There is only about 5mm between the bolt and the corner of the cam cover. How are you supposed to remove these bolts without removing the belts and pully. It is so close, but I just can't get an allen key to sit in the bolts. arghhhhhhhh...... |

944 hall sensor replacement
The hall sensor isn't critical to the running of the engine but without it the engine will default to 6 degrees of advance rather than optimal timing. No need to remove any belts or pulleys. Only the camshaft cover which leaves better access to the 2 allen bolts. The cheap, shiny-metal allen keys are quite malleable and with a propane torch you can shape them as needed after cutting short the "L" to about 1/4" or less. Then you will have a positive grip on the bolts. Make sure your newly-created tool is fully seated in the bolt before you apply force. This should remove the bolt. When re-installing use a screwdriver, not an allen key. At tools-are-us you can buy a set of extra-long skinny screwdrivers for a few dollars. Use one that fits snugly into the bolt and then tighten. A hideous amount of torque is not needed to hold the sensor in place so the screwdriver will be adequate to facillitate re-installation and future removal of the bolt. Re-install the camshaft cover with a thin coating of Hylomar on both the head and the rubber gasket and you will have no leaks. Watch the torque on the camshaft cover bolts. They can cost $20-30 each from the dealer and can snap off in the head above 8nm. A scope will be able to show that the variable ignition timing has been restored rather than the default 6 degrees and full engine power will return. Hope this is helpful. John

My hall sensor plug crumbled. I pushed the terminals into the harness plug and dabbed some liquid electrical tape around everything. The sensor itself seems like it is ok, just the connector was damaged.
That spot gets pretty hot since the exhaust, heater coolant pipe and head are all nearby so the plastic plug won't last forever but the sensor itself is in the distributor and doesn't get as hot, and seems fine. |
